November 12, 20223 yr 1 minute ago, carlito777 said: Have you tried FSR2? I have but i think for my system the limiting factor is the CPU so i get no real frame rate benefit and i prefer the sharpness of TAA. If my Monitor was 4k then i think then FSR would make a difference. But as of now for 1440P i have headroom with the graphics card which allows me to increase the renderscale for even better image quality. In addition to that FSR gave me a little bit of artifacting in the engine spinners of the pmdg 737 when i tested it out and has a slightly blurry presentation that required a bit of sharpening. November 12, 20223 yr 4 hours ago, carlito777 said: Anyone else with AMD graphics card also experiencing heavy stutters with the new version? The old version was butter smooth, but with the update my sim became virtually unusable. You did not by chance observe the heavy stuttering using the A310? This plane has currently a WASM compiler bug that affects some users resulting in ridiculous performance. I initially thought that something completely broke my sim until I read about the issue.
